Makelin Lemoine’s Breakout Season Puts Elton High on the Map

Junior running back’s dual-threat performance earns Louisiana Sports Illustrated’s top honor

The 2025 football season has become a showcase for Makelin Lemoine, a junior running back whose name now resonates beyond the small town of Elton, Louisiana. Known for his relentless work ethic and versatile skill set, Lemoine has emerged as the centerpiece of Elton High’s offensive attack and a surprising force on defense.

On the offensive side of the ball, Lemoine compiled almost 2,500 rushing yards, a tally that places him among the most prolific backs in recent state history. He crossed the goal line 40 times, each touchdown a product of speed, vision, and a willingness to take on defenders head‑on. Coaches praise his ability to read defenses and exploit gaps, while teammates cite his leadership as a catalyst for the team’s overall confidence.

His impact is not limited to the ground game. Lemoine also recorded three interceptions, showcasing a knack for reading quarterbacks and turning defensive plays into scoring opportunities. This dual‑threat capability has forced opposing teams to adjust their strategies, often dedicating extra resources to contain his runs.

Honors and Accolades

The culmination of his season came in January when the Louisiana Sports Illustrated editorial board named him the Class 1A Football Player of the Year. The award highlights not only his statistical dominance but also his role in putting Elton High School on the broader football map. Lemoine, humbled by the recognition, says the honor fuels his ambition to continue raising the program’s profile.
